Three People Arrested In Bethel Park After Shots Were Fired

March 15, 2024 4:54 pm

(WPXI) – An investigation into a shots fired incident on Friday led to a police pursuit in the South Hills and three people taken into custody. At 11:40 a.m., police responded to a report of shots fired into a home in the 800 block of Third Street in Clairton.  Around 30 minutes later, officers with Whitehall and Brentwood police departments spotted the vehicle involved along Route 51 and attempted to pull it over. Police said three males ran from the vehicle during the traffic stop. Officers were able to take one of them into custody, while the other two got back into the vehicle and fled the scene. The vehicle was spotted again a short time later in Bethel Park, where officers began to pursue it. At 12:44 p.m., police said the driver of the suspect vehicle lost control and crashed at the intersection of Library and Clifton roads. The two males who were inside got out and fled on foot. Both were taken into custody following a brief foot pursuit. Police said a gun was also recovered during the investigation. Allegheny County Police are investigating.
